Obama team acts fast to change subject
San Francisco Chronicle ^ | 1/11/9 | Phillip Matier, Andrew Ross

Posted on 01/11/2009 9:44:44 AM PST by SmithL

No sooner did New Mexico Gov. Bill Richardson withdraw his nomination as secretary of commerce amid a "pay-to-play" grand jury investigation back home than word leaked that former California Rep. Leon Panetta was being named CIA chief.

The timing was no coincidence.

A Washington source tells us the Panetta nod wasn't due for another week, but that once Barack Obama's transition team "saw the Richardson train wreck coming, someone thought it would be smart to get reporters talking about something else, fast."

It worked with reporters. Unfortunately, the ploy frosted incoming Senate Intelligence Committee chair Dianne Feinstein, who was not happy she found out by reading the CNN crawl.

By the way, newsroom colleague Michael Taylor passed on a joke making the rounds among New Mexico lawyers:

What's the difference between Illinois Gov. Rod Blagojevich and Richardson?

One had his phone tapped.
